All i know about him is from here. No actual experience. Sorry if that was a dead end referral.

But that graphic is simple enough to build a graphic template yourself.

Take a photo square on, upload it and outline its edges in msPaint. Then white everything else out with the box tool until you have only the line drawing of the edges. Then take a measurement of the vertical and horizontal for scale, and bring it to the flea market. Down by me, there's a guy at every flea market that does vinyl decals. Calvin pissing on every auto logo ever made, etc. They usually can do custom stickers and should be able to crank that out no problem if you have a simple bitmap file to start with. Try it. Once you get the hang of it, should be easy to design. Give it a shot!

Wait a minute. Does the portion right under your keyhole have diagonal cut lines in between the gradient?

That could be simply 3" or 4" wide gold tape film in several transparency gradients. I've seen stripe installers make a custom graphic simply by layering the gradients diagonally, then straight edge cutting the top and bottom. I can't tell from the pic but the whole thing could be custom done on the truck.

You could have that done if you find a tape striper at your local truck dealer. Some place that does extensive wide film custom designs, like a conversation van dealer, etc.

I swear I've seen that graphic on a Mitsubishi mighty max, but just can't remember clearly.

Cruise the detail bays of your local car dealers, ask around. You may find a guy to do it for cash.
